Why It’s Hard to Break That Smoking Habit – And What You Can Do About It!
Breaking the habit of smoking tobacco is without a doubt seldom easy. This is partly due to the nicotine content of cigarettes, Nicotine is an alkaloid compound found in tobacco that acts on the human brain as a stimulant. When tobacco smoke is inhaled the smoke contains minute quantities of nicotine which is absorbed into the bloodstream and brings about a sense of relaxation as well as a slight feeling of light headedness.
Giving Up Smoking For Good
The numerous benefits when giving up smoking for good begins the moment you’ve put out your last cigarette as the body has the amazing ability to start healing itself and slowly but surely reversing the ravages of smoking over the years. So please never make the mistake of thinking you might be too old to for giving up smoking for good or that you have been smoking for too long so quitting would make no difference now. It couldn’t be further from the truth.

American Public Health Association Commends House Passage Of Tobacco Legislation
Statement from Georges C. Benjamin MD, FACP, FACEP (EP), Executive Director, American Public Health Association The American Public Health Association applauds the U.S. House of Representatives for today passing the Family Smoking and Tobacco Control Act with an overwhelming bipartisan majority. The legislation aims to protect the health of Americans, particularly children, by giving the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) the authority to regulate tobacco products.
